Dumb Money

Watching Dumb Money is probably a lot like participating the real GameStop stock buying revolution: I’m not 100% sure what’s going on, but I’m having a great time.

If you somehow missed it, this dude on Reddit started talking about GameStop stock and a bunch of people joined in and easily topped the very fragile system that the billionaires get rich off of. The memes were top-notch, as were the returns.

The Paris Orphan

Supermodel Jess randomly decides to become a war correspondent during WW2. There she meets Captain Dan and his ward Victorine. As if war isn’t brutal enough, let’s add a bit of drama, shall we?

Fast-forward six decades and art curator Darcy arrives in Paris to pack up some famous photos. What she doesn’t realize is they hold answers to questions none of us knew we should ask regarding Jess, Victorine, and Dan. Which can all be summed up as: too much.

Daisy Darker

Daisy Darker and her family are convening for Nana’s 80th birthday party on Halloween. As guests start dying, and family keeps lying, there’s a chance none of the Darker’s will make it to next Halloween.

Alice Feeney is a great writer. I’ve read three other books and while I always figure out ‘the twist’ early on… Alice doubles-down and makes me realize I only knew the half of it. Except with Daisy. The thing I realized was the only thing. And I was crushed. So proceed with low expectations.

Hit Man

Nice guy Gary is promoted at his side gig when he has to become a fake hit man for the New Orleans police dept. He’s eerily good at it. Until he meets a potential ‘client’ that changes everything.

And just like that, I will now see every Glenn Powell movie that has ever and will ever exist. Period.
